Tottenham Hotspur have a multitude of players currently away on international duty, testament to how much quality is currently within the Spurs ranks.
For instance, Spurs trio Ben Davies, Brennan Johnson and Joe Rodon will be hoping to get Wales over the line and into the finals of Euro 2024.
Meanwhile, Tottenham captain Son Heung-min is in 2026 World Cup qualifying action with South Korea.
However, many of Spurs’ senior players will be contesting friendlies, with several of those having already played their first March international match.
Argentina – for whom Tottenham’s Cristian Romero and Giovani Lo Celso play – is one of those nations, having picked up a 3-0 win over El Salvador on Friday night.

Indeed, both Romero and Lo Celso scored for the reigning world champions.
And both Spurs players then took to Instagram after the match to express their delight in shining for their nation.
Romero. who wrote “how much I missed you”, picked up praise from the likes of Pedro Porro, Lo Celso, Leandro Paredes and Rodrigo De Paul in the comments.
Meanwhile, Lo Celso took to Insta to write “nothing more beautiful than being able to live all this.”
The likes of James Maddison, Angel Di Maria, Porro and Paredes all responded in the comments.
Maddison posted two applause emojis, while Porro wrote ‘game’.

It’s nice to see Lo Celso get praise from Spurs teammates as well as from some of his world-class compatriots.
All in all, a solid display for Lo Celso, who once again shows his quality for his nation despite struggling for opportunities at Tottenham.
Lo Celso has sadly never really got going at Spurs following his £27million move years ago, for one reason or another.
It would be nice to see him get a chance at Tottenham, but honestly, a player of his quality – a key squad member for the world champions – should be getting regular football.
